Output 86f3d8a1129ebff8a7bd4b417c312bfab93a90ffe2fc4c271d7d0db758c4bc3f:1

value
2976120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61956c8c989391ee571135427ba6da3734713649 OP_EQUAL
address
3AazUKBPFp1W9hY1qtTz5VvPi71y72EpNh
transaction
86f3d8a1129ebff8a7bd4b417c312bfab93a90ffe2fc4c271d7d0db758c4bc3f
confirmations
297633
spent
true